About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- Independently translates unstructured business issues/requests into action plans and projects that result in high quality deliverables that impact the business
- Integrate insights from a variety of sources (market research, competitive intelligence, secondary data) to address business needs and influence critical go/no-go decision
- Lead design and facilitation of internal workshops to build a shared cross-functional understanding of current hypotheses, key gaps and forward-looking action plans
- Partners with Therapeutic Area leadership to inform and influence therapeutic area strategy
- Plan, design and conduct primary market research for multiple assets in various stages of product lifecycle to enable strategic decision making
- Conduct ad hoc strategic secondary analytics to inform strategic decisions
- Clearly communicate ideas and insights via written or verbal presentation and influences leadership to incorporate findings and insights
- Lead cross-region / cross-portfolio initiatives in collaboration with key stakeholders in global, regional, and local commercial teams
- Set priorities, develop and manage multiple projects and timelines simultaneously
Requirements
What you’ll need- Doctorate degree and 2 years of commercial insights or consulting experience OR Master’s degree and 4 years of commercial insights or consulting experience OR Bachelor’s degree and 6 years of commercial insights or consulting experience OR Associate’s degree and 10 years of commercial insights or consulting experience OR High school diploma / GED and 12 years of commercial insights or consulting experience
- Ability to extract, analyze, treat, and consolidate data from different sources in clear and concise formats with rigor and high level of accuracy
- Strong knowledge of drug development the pharmaceutical industry
- Experience leading primary market research
- Ability to think strategically to support key business decisions
- Ability to work collaboratively in team-based environment across different functional groups
- Excellent presentation skills with ability to explain complex concepts and controversial findings clearly to a variety of audiences, including senior management
- Skilled in prioritizing multiple responsibilities, priorities, tasks, and projects simultaneously
- Experience with commonly used biopharmaceutical industry datasets and databases
- Experience managing multiple stakeholders, prioritizing across a multitude of responsibilities, and allocating bandwidth to drive maximum impact
- Prior experience in strategy/management consulting in the biopharma industry preferably through a lead role.
